What's The Definition Of Adenine?
adenine in American English
a white, crystalline purine base, C5H5N5, contained in the DNA, RNA, and ADP of all tissue: it links with thymine in the DNA structure noun: a purine base, C5H5N5, one of the fundamental components of nucleic acids, as DNA, in which it forms a base pair with thymine, and RNA, in which it pairs with uracil adenine in British English noun: a purine base present in tissues of all living organisms as a constituent of the nucleic acids DNA and RNA and of certain coenzymes; 6-aminopurine. Formula: C5 H5N5; melting pt: 360–365°C |
